There are many different styles of boxes you can choose. Here are some of the common used styles. Choose the style that suits your needs best:
Slotted StylesRegulated Slotted Container-RSC
International Box Code: 0201
Overlap Slotted Containers-OSC
International Box Code: 0202
Full-Overlap Slotted Containers-FOL
International Box Code: 0203
Snap-Bottom Box
International Box Code: 0216 Telescope BoxesFull-Telescope Design-Style Box-FTD
Inernational Code 0301
Full-Telescope Half-Slotted Box-FTHS
International Code: 0320
Half-Slotted Box with Cover- HSC
International Code:0312
Double cover Box-DC
International Code: 0310 FoldersOne Piece Folder-1PF
International Code: 0401
Two-Piece Folder-2PF
International Code: 0404
Self-Locking Tray
International Code: 0422
Tuck Folder
International Code: 0420 Slide-Type BoxesDouble-Slide Box-DS
International Code: 0510 Rigid BoxesBliss Boxes
International Code: 0605 Self-Erecting BoxesSelf-Erecting Boxes
International Code: 0711 Interiors FormsInteriors
International Box Code: 09 Liners, shells or tubes, pads, build-ups, dividers, partitions and other inner packing pieces can be made in an infinite variety of ways to separate or cushion products, to strengthen the box, or to prevent product movement by filling voids. They may be simple rectangles, or scored, slotted, scored and slotted, or die-cut shapes. Here is a brief introduction of them:
